Iraq 50 Fils (King Faisal II)

Country of Origin: Iraq

Year of Issue: 1953 (AH 1372)

Denomination: 50 Fils

Composition: Silver (.500)

Brief Description

The reverse features the denomination '50' in large numerals within a central circle, surrounded by the country's name and stars along the rim. The obverse (not fully visible) typically features the portrait of King Faisal II.

Historical Significance

This coin was issued during the reign of King Faisal II, the last King of Iraq. It represents the Hashemite monarchy era before the 1958 revolution. The 1953 issue marks a period of modernization in Iraq prior to political upheaval.

Care Instructions

Keep in a cool, dry place. Handle by the edges to avoid transferring skin oils to the metal. Do not clean or polish, as this can severely reduce the numismatic value of silver coins.
